An offence under section 170 of the Customs and Excise Management Act 1979 (c. 2) of being knowingly concerned, in relation to any goods, in any fraudulent evasion or attempt at evasion of a prohibition in force with respect to the goods under section 42 of the Customs Consolidation Act 1876 (c. 36) (prohibition on importing indecent or obscene articles).

Sexual Offences Act 2003

18

Section 1 (rape).

19

Section 2 (assault by penetration).

20

Section 4 (causing a person to engage in sexual activity without consent), where the activity caused involved penetration within subsection (4)(a) to (d) of that section.

21

Section 5 (rape of a child under 13).

22

Section 6 (assault of a child under 13 by penetration).

23

Section 8 (causing or inciting a child under 13 to engage in sexual activity), where an activity involving penetration within subsection (3)(a) to (d) of that section was caused.

Domestic Violence, Crime and Victims Act 2004

24

Section 5 (causing or allowing the death of a child or vulnerable adult).

Sexual Offences Act 2003

25

Section 31 (causing or inciting a person, with a mental disorder impeding choice, to engage in sexual activity), where an activity involving penetration within subsection (3)(a) to (d) of that section was caused.
